Oceanfront Home Overlooking Penobscot Bay , Castine Maine.<br>History abounds !

Roomy three bedroom, three level home on the ocean. Rated five-stars since its initial listing ( globally) in 2015. we have hosted families from Paris Fr., Hong Kong, Australia, as well as numerous states here in the U.S.

The open-living main floor has Maine granite counter top kitchen, dining area, and sitting area with hardwood floors and cathedral ceiling. All three floors have large picture windows which provide beautiful views across Penobscot Bay with breathtaking sunsets. The main floor also has a 3/4 bathroom with oversize shower. A three season sunroom on the south side and front of the home, with a wide wrap around deck on the west and north sides.

The upper level balcony has a spacious bedroom with cathedral ceiling, two queen beds, two dressers, large closet, and a full bath with whirlpool tub/shower. This level also provides picturesque views of the ocean thru
large front windows.

The lower level has two bedrooms, full bath, and laundry room. Bedroom 1 has two twin beds. Bedroom 2 has 1 double bed, both offering amazing ocean views and walk-in closets. This lower level opens onto the large front lawn ( facing the ocean ) for games and family outings, large picnic tables, stainless steel barbecue grill and lobster steamer. All tools/utensils are provided, incl. gas bottles.

4 Old Town Otter kayaks and 1 new double seat kayak ,paddles, lawn games, fire pit on the lawn, picnic table with ample chairs,
outdoor seating on brick patio.
Detached garage with circular drive, parking for five cars, on a quiet private road. A caretaker is nearby to assist with any problems and lawn mowing, and an emergency generator is on the premises.l

Why they chose this property

Built in 1973, the original owner/builders from Cape Cod were all about details. The house was positioned facing slightly South, to afford spectacular sunsets all year long across our front windows. The neighborhood is on a private dirt road, and very quiet, although only a 5 minute drive from Main St in downtown Castine. Our home boasts cathedral ceilings, oil baseboard heating and air conditioning on the main levels and in the bedrooms. The large wrap around porch and sunroom are the perfect places to enjoy the sunset, listen to the waves or have your morning coffee.

What makes this property unique

Peace and quiet with exceptional views across Wadsworth Cove and Penobscot Bay, Islesboro Island and Camden Hills in background. Flowering trees and shrubs, wild roses, geese , sea ducks, and deer families grazing on the lawns of a nearby estate. Unique public beach at end of road, safe swimming/boating/ beach-combing.
